subscriber ethnicitysubscr_ethn

The self-reported or administratively assigned ethnic classification of the primary insurance policy holder. Captured during member enrollment and used in population health analytics, HEDIS reporting, and health equity initiatives to identify and address disparate care outcomes.

subscriber expiration datesubscr_exp_dt

The date on which a subscriber's insurance policy or enrollment record is no longer valid within payer and member enrollment systems. Used by data engineers to filter active eligibility records, trigger renewal workflows, and validate claims against coverage periods in adjudication pipelines.

subscriber external identifiersubscr_ext_id

A unique identifier assigned to the primary insurance policy holder by an external system, such as a state Medicaid registry, employer benefits platform, or clearinghouse. Enables cross-system record matching and data reconciliation during claims adjudication and eligibility verification.

subscriber faxsubscr_fax

The facsimile contact number associated with the primary insurance policy holder. Used in member enrollment records to support document transmission for eligibility verification, authorization requests, and correspondence related to insurance coverage and benefits administration.

subscriber feesubscr_fee

The periodic premium or administrative charge assessed to the primary insurance policy holder for maintaining health plan coverage. Captured in member enrollment and billing systems to track payment obligations, reconcile premium collections, and support financial reporting for the health plan.

subscriber first namesubscr_first_nm

The given (first) name of the primary insured individual as recorded in member enrollment, EHR, and payer systems. Used by data engineers for identity matching, HIPAA-compliant member deduplication, and constructing full name fields across eligibility and claims datasets.

subscriber flagsubscr_flg

Boolean indicator identifying whether a member record represents a primary subscriber versus a dependent within compliance and enrollment systems. Used by data engineers to segment populations, filter eligibility files, drive reporting logic, and route records through correct processing pipelines in payer and PBM integrations.

subscriber frequencysubscr_freq

The recurring interval at which premiums or other charges are billed to the primary insurance policy holder, such as monthly, quarterly, or annually. Used in member enrollment and billing systems to schedule payment cycles and manage premium collection workflows.

subscriber full namesubscr_full_nm

The concatenated display name (typically first, middle, and last name) of the primary insured individual as stored in member enrollment and payer systems. Used by data engineers for member-facing reporting, identity resolution, and matching records across EHR, claims, and pharmacy data sources.

subscriber gendersubscr_gndr

The gender identity or biological sex classification recorded for the primary insurance policy holder. Captured during member enrollment and used in eligibility determination, claims adjudication, coverage rule validation, and population health reporting across the health plan.

subscriber group numbersubscr_grp_nbr

The logical identifier assigned to the employer or organization sponsoring a group health insurance policy, found in 834 EDI enrollment transactions and claims data. Used by data engineers to link members to benefit plans, employer contracts, and group-level analytics in payer and PBM systems.

subscriber indexsubscr_idx

A positional or sequence number identifying a subscriber record within a sorted or ordered dataset in member enrollment and payer systems. Used by data engineers for record ordering, batch processing, pagination of large eligibility files, and maintaining referential integrity across downstream analytics pipelines.

subscriber indicatorsubscr_ind

A yes/no or binary flag denoting whether an individual is the primary subscriber on a health insurance policy within enrollment and claims systems. Used by data engineers to distinguish subscribers from dependents in eligibility datasets, 834 EDI files, and member-level reporting aggregations.

subscriber instructionsubscr_instr

Free-text or coded guidance associated with a subscriber record in payer and member enrollment systems, often capturing special handling notes for eligibility or billing. Used by data engineers to parse and route operational directives within enrollment processing workflows and downstream system integrations.

subscriber keysubscr_key

A surrogate or natural key value that uniquely identifies the primary insurance policy holder record within the data warehouse or enrollment system. Used as the primary join attribute when linking subscriber data to dependent, claims, eligibility, and coverage records across healthcare data models.

subscriber labelsubscr_lbl

A human-readable display text or descriptive tag associated with the primary insurance policy holder record. Used in member enrollment interfaces, reporting dashboards, and correspondence generation to present subscriber identity in a standardized, user-friendly format across health plan systems.

subscriber languagesubscr_lang

The preferred spoken or written language of the primary insurance policy holder, captured during member enrollment. Used to ensure compliance with language access requirements, route translated materials, and coordinate interpreter services for clinical and administrative communications.

subscriber last namesubscr_last_nm

The family (last) name of the primary insured individual as recorded in member enrollment, claims, and payer systems. Used by data engineers in probabilistic and deterministic member matching algorithms, HIPAA identity verification, and constructing standardized name fields across EHR and eligibility datasets.

subscriber legal namesubscr_legal_nm

The full official name of the primary insurance policy holder as it appears on government-issued identification or legal documents. Used in member enrollment, claims adjudication, and eligibility verification to ensure accurate identity matching and compliance with insurance regulatory requirements.
